WitrynaStep 2 Wizard 1/6: Add a new surface. To make an intensity based 3D segmentation in the “3D View” go to the “Scene – Properties” pane and click the blue Icon “Add new Surface”. The surface creation wizard starts. Select “Segment only a Region of Interest” and “Process entire Image finally”. This allows you to do your ... Witryna13 lip 2024 · You can open the Display adjustment menu by going to Edit -> Show Display Adjustment. In the window that opens, click Channel Names and assign new colors: green for live cells (Ch1) and red for dead cells (Ch2).
